The Wal-Mart model isn't the ideal concept for the US economy, the idea of importing cheap products from 3rd world nations to sell to US consumers who are suffering as a result from the globalization is pretty stupid.
The worst thing is the money also leaves the local communities, Wal-Mart profits DO NOT filter back into the local economies, the money returns to the people at the top, that's counterproductive.
There was a day in American when all the retail stores were owned by local residents, they were a part of the local economy, their prosperity helped the people in those areas, Wal-Mart does the complete opposite!!
